MEMO — Dispatch desk. A locked transit case containing eight test devices for the Brellick field trial ships on today's 14:00 run. Case stays sealed; the key travels separately and is not our concern. Driver signs custody form at pickup and again at drop. Case rides up front, never in the open bed. Temperature limits apply — no idling in direct sun over lunch. Report any tampering immediately to the duty manager. Hand-over instruction follows.

handover note for yagef-bagep: the drudor pelius courier leaves the kasdor zorvan norir ledger at gate 8016 under passcode 755406

**Handover: Inkwright markdown pipeline (Doss → Vann)**

Renderer is stable. Known issue: nested tables inside blockquotes occasionally drop cells — fix is merged, ships next deploy. If render latency pages fire, restart the sanitizer worker first; it leaks memory under heavy footnote load. Don't touch the plugin registry without a config freeze. Escalation order, restart commands, and the deploy calendar are on the internal page here.

wiki page, tahaf-tajog: https://jira.ordindyn.corp/pipeline

Handover: GrainLink gateway, from Petra to whoever's next. Polls tractor CAN units every 30s, pushes to the Harrowfield broker. Watch the MQTT reconnect loop — it starves under packet loss. Logs rotate daily. Deploy via the silo-sync script only. The values the service currently runs with are listed below.

settings of tagef-bawif:
DRUIX_HOST=druix.zemvarlabs.internal
DRUIX_PORT=8000

Quick heads-up for support: the Pedalport rebalancer is getting busier now that the Harborview docks are live. Each rebalancing run scans every station, so runtime grows with fleet size. If customers report stale availability, check whether runs are backing up before escalating. We sized the workers around the limits shown here.

tuning table, yajog-yahof:
BUDGETS = {
    "lamvan": 303,
    "wenox": 460,
    "fenvan": 525,
}